Today, Congressman Andy Biggs sent a letter to White House Press Secretary Karine Jean-Pierre to formally invite her to tour the Arizona-Mexico border with him--making him the first member serving in Congress to do so--in response to her comments made during a White House press briefing on August 29, 2022.
"White House Press Secretary Karine Jean-Pierre's continued dismissal of the nation's border crisis is outrageous," said Congressman Andy Biggs. "As the chief spokesperson of the President of the United States, she is either deliberately lying to the American public or is utterly unaware of this catastrophe that stretches across the nation's 2,000-mile border with Mexico.
"As a representative of a border state and as the Congressional Border Security Caucus co-chair, I encourage Press Secretary Jean-Pierre to join me for a border tour along the Arizona-Mexico border.
"Failure to accept this invitation suggests that she and the Biden White House are not interested in correcting their self-inflicted border crisis and will allow it to worsen."
